Abstract
COPD is associated with different comorbid diseases, and their frequency increases with age. Comorbidities severely impact costs of health care, intensity of symptoms, quality of life and, most importantly, may contribute to life span shortening. Some comorbidities are well acknowledged and established in doctors' awareness. However, both everyday practice and literature searches provide evidence of other, less recognized diseases, which are frequently associated with COPD. We call them underrecognized comorbidities, and the reason why this is so may be related to their relatively low clinical significance, inefficient literature data, or data ambiguity. In this review, we describe rhinosinusitis, skin abnormalities, eye diseases, different endocrinological disorders, and gastroesophageal reflux disease. Possible links to COPD pathogenesis have been discussed, if the data were available.Entities:

Inclusion and exclusion criteria for underrecognized COPD comorbidities
| Inclusion criteria | 1. Coexistent chronic disease |
| 2. Higher frequency compared to general population | |
| Exclusion criteria | 1. Listed in GOLD 2015 report |
| 2. Related to treatment | |
| 3. Related exclusively to smoking habit | |
| 4. COPD complications |
Abbreviation: GOLD, Global Initiative for Chronic Obstructive Lung Disease.

List of the most relevant papers per condition
| Search area | References | Year | Number of patients | COPD patients | Prevalence |
|---|---|---|---|---|---|
| Rhinosinusitis | Roberts et al | 2003 | 61 | 61 | 75.4% |
| Piotrowska et al | 2010 | 63 | 42 | 97.6% | |
| Kelemence et al | 2011 | 90 | 90 | 53% | |
| Skin abnormalities | Patel et al | 2006 | 149 | 68 | 31% |
| Endocrinological disorders | Laghi et al | 2005 | 101 | 101 | 38% |
| Mousavi et al | 2012 | 140 | 140 | 58.6% | |
| Terzano et al | 2014 | 155 | 155 | Hyperthyroidism 32.3% | |
| GERD | Divo et al | 2012 | 1,664 | 1,664 | 17.7% |
| Martinez et al | 2014 | 4,483 | 4,483 | 29% | |
| Miyazaki et al | 2014 | 403 | 336 | 34% | |
| Terada et al | 2008 | 122 | 82 | 26.8% | |
| Ajmera et al | 2014 | 2,461 | 2,461 | 29.3% |
Abbreviation: GERD, gastroesophageal reflux disease.
